학령기 아동의 사고예방 교육안 개발 및 평가 (Development and Evaluation of Injury Prevention Education Proposal for Elementary School Children)

  • 이정은;김지현;김신정
    • Child Health Nursing Research
    • /
    • 제8권4호
    • /
    • pp.365-380
    • /
    • 2002
  • This study was to develop and evaluate injury prevention education proposal which will helpful and can be utilized directly on the first line spot for elementary school children. Education proposal development and evaluation process was 1) Construction of 10-times education proposal contents proper to schooler 2) Testify validity through 3 pediatric nursing professor and 4 elementary school nurse 3) Pretest was done from March, 2002 to July on 3-6th grade 313 elementary school students 4) Through correction and revision after pretest evaluation meeting, final injury prevention education proposal was developed 5) After 10-times injury education, evaluation was carried out about the degree of help in education contents and general constitution of injury education to total subjects of educated children. Injury prevention education proposal consists of 10 times and each subjects are followings. 1st is 「introduction of injury prevention education and the importance of injury prevention」 2nd is「safety in and around home」, 3rd is 「injury prevention in school」, 4th is 「prevention of violence」, 5th is 「motor vehicle safety」, 6th is 「water safety」, 7th is 「prevention of fire and burns」, 8th is 「toy and product safety」, 9th is 「sports and recretional activities safety」and the final 10th is 「injury prevention caused by animals」. In the evaluation, the degree of help in education contents showed it helped to children averaged 1.66 and general constitution showed averaged 2.17 that children satisfied about developed injury prevention proposal. This study expected to provide systematic and concrete guidance in injury prevention education for elementary school children.

장루 보유자 교육용 자료에 대한 조사 연구 (A Survey on the Ostomate Education Materials)

  • 박경숙;김명숙;최경숙
    • 대한간호학회지
    • /
    • 제28권3호
    • /
    • pp.705-717
    • /
    • 1998
  • Ostomates have suffered from many difficulties due to their physical, psychosocial handicaps and changes of life style to include ostoma management that influences their daily and quality of life. An appropriate nursing education for ostoma management is very important. Practical educational materials needs revision because those were developed by pharmaceutical companies and hospital institutions. The purpose of this study is to provide more practical and reasonable education materials for ostomates by doing analysis and survey of educational materials now being used. We surveyed 8 types of educational materials used in 23 university hospitals and medical centers in Seoul ; four of them were developed by department of nursing and the remainder by an Ostomy Company Data, collected from July 14, 1997 through July 31, 1997 were analyzed. The results are as follows ; 1. The analysis of education guide, on ostomate included 14 subcategories : introduction, structure and function of gastrointestinal tracts, definition of stoma, types of ostomy, definition of peristalsis, methods of defecation management, selection of instrument, resolution of problems and general situations following surgery, daily life, where to ask for help, explanations for terms, information about where to buy instrument, explanations for enterostomal therapist, a matter of consultation with doctor, etc. 2. Introduction contained specific contents on practical ostomate management that ostomates would experience through their lives. Ostomate education guides were developed 3 hospitals except one which missed this point. 3. Most ostomate education guides, except one hospital, helped ostomates to understand their physical structure changes with specific explanations on gastrointestinal tracts with figures. 4. Six institutions did not talk about the definition of peristalsis. 5. All institutions, except two, helped ostomates to understand types of ostomy with figures. 6. More detailed explanations on natural defecation are needed. The benefits and pitfalls of natural defecation should be more specified. 7 No psychosocial difficulties of ostomy management were addressed. 8. The efficiency of enema can be better understood through all explanations with figures. Some institutions did not mention items about definition, benefits, pitfalls of enema, sequency of enema, how to wash, cautions performing and enema, skin management, cleaning instrument after enema proper time to spend. 9. There were no detailed contents and what to do in case of not being able to do enema. 10. Only one educational material mentioned emotional aspects after the surgrey. 11. Most institutions explained subcategory of daily life but did not provide specific contents on the difficulties of physical, psychological, and sociocultural controls. 12. The subcategory of ureterostomy education guides included explanations on normal structure and function of urinary tracts, types of ureterostomy, how to manage skin, usage and types of instrument, commercial urostomy, how to manage instrument, daily life, introduced the general contents. However, more specific explanations were needed.

간호대학생의 신종 감염병에 대한 인식, 신종 감염병 상황에서의 윤리 인식과 윤리적 의사결정 (Awareness about Pandemic Infectious Diseases, Ethical Awareness, and Ethical Decision-making among Nursing Students)

  • 김윤수;홍성실
    • 한국보건간호학회지
    • /
    • 제33권3호
    • /
    • pp.326-339
    • /
    • 2019
  • Purpose: This study attempts to identify the level of awareness, ethical awareness, and decision-making among nursing students, in response to pandemic infectious diseases. Methods: Subjects were 210 nursing college students attending colleges in 5 cities and provinces nationwide. Data were collected from November 2017 to April 2018 using a self-administrated questionnaire, and analyzed utilizing descriptive statistics. Results: Considering the awareness of pandemic infectious diseases, the nursing students expressed high concern about the possibility of future outbreaks of pandemic infectious diseases and seriousness of the situation. There were numerous negative views on the response and stockpiling of drugs by the government. Ethical awareness of pandemic infectious diseases was high, with demands for accurate information and proper protective equipment. Overall, ethical decision-making when responding to pandemic infectious diseases represented a high score. Also, higher awareness levels of pandemic infectious diseases would result in increased ethical and ethical decision-making. Conclusion: In conclusion, we propose the introduction of an ethical education program for medical personnel and nursing university students, to enable the handling of future pandemic outbreaks of new infectious diseases.

간호윤리 교육현황 - 4년제 대학교육을 중심으로 - (The Status of Nursing Ethics Education in Korea 4-year-College of Nursing)

  • 한성숙;김용순;엄영란;안성희
    • 한국간호교육학회지
    • /
    • 제5권2호
    • /
    • pp.376-387
    • /
    • 1999
  • 본 연구는 국내 대학교의 간호학과에서 이루어지고 있는 간호윤리교육의 현황을 파악함으로써 앞으로 나아갈 방향을 제시하는데 기초자료를 제공하기 위한 목적으로 조사되었다. 본 연구는 서술적 조사연구로써, 연구대상은 전국의 4년제 대학 간호학과 48개교이나 졸업생을 1회 이상 배출한 37개 대학을 대상으로 선정하여 31개 대학으로부터 자료를 수집하였으나 자료가 미비한 3개 대학은 제외하고 28개 대학의 자료를 최종 분석하였다. 자료수집방법은 현재 시행되고 있는 간호윤리 교육 현황을 조사하기 위하여 구조화된 질문지를 이용하였으며, 수집기간은 1999년 7월 19일부터 8월 4일까지였다. 자료분석은 빈도와 백분율을 사용하였다. 본 연구 결과는 다음과 같다. 1. 간호윤리학을 독립과목으로 운영하여 교육하는 대학은 6개교(21.43%)이며, 이수 학점은 모두 2학점으로 총 교육 시간의 평균은 28.67시간이었다. 2. 강의 목표는 간호전문직과 직업윤리관 확립, 간호윤리의 철학적 기초 및 윤리이론과 원리의 이해, 생명의료윤리의 주요주제들의 학습, 인간생명 존중의 가치관 확립, 간호전문직과 윤리강령의 학습, 간호현장에서의 도덕적인 제 문제에 윤리 이론 적용 간호사와 대상자, 협동자, 동료간의 윤리적 갈등의 이해와 해결 등이다. 3. 교육방법으로는 이론강의, 사례토론, 주제토론, 비디오상영 및 토론, 팀 교육, 역할 극, 보고서 제출 등 매우 다양하였다. 4. 교육내용으로 6개교 모두에서 다루는 것이 간호전문직과 윤리, 인간생명의 존엄성, 생명윤리의 필요성, 윤리이론 규칙, 간호사 윤리강령, 간호사와 대상자간의 윤리 문제, 간호사와 협동자간의 윤리문제, 간호사와 간호사간의 윤리문제이며, 5개교에서 윤리적 의사결정, 인공수정, 체외수정. 인공임신중절, 장기이식, 뇌사, 인간대상 실험연구, 자살, 안락사에 대하여 다루었으며, 말기환자 간호는 4개교에서, 기타 직업윤리 및 환자의 권리, 간호사와 사회기관, 생명의 관리자를 다루고 있었다. 5. 평가방법은 대개 필답시험과 리포트에 의존하고 있었다. 6. 간호윤리학이 독립과목이 아닌 22(78.57%)개 대학의 경우, 간호윤리를 간호학개론과목 (14개교)에서, 또한 간호관리학, 간호윤리.철학, 기타과목(간호특론, 간호와 법, 간호전문직론) 등에서 간호윤리학을 교육하였다. 7. 교육과정을 살펴보면, 1학년에서 가르치는 학교가 14개교로 가장 많았고, 가르치는 평균 시간은 9.32시간으로 나타났다. 교육내용으로는 독립과목에서 가르치는 내용과 유사한 것으로 나타났다.

수용개작방법을 활용한 유치도뇨 간호실무지침 개발 (Development of Indwelling Urinary Catheterization Guideline by Adaptation Process)

  • 정인숙;정재심;서현주;임은영;홍은영;박경희;정영선;최은경;박희연;박선아
    • 임상간호연구
    • /
    • 제21권1호
    • /
    • pp.31-42
    • /
    • 2015
  • Purpose: This study was done to develop evidence-based nursing practice guidelines to prevent complications related to indwelling urinary catheterization (IUC) in patients in Korea. Methods: A guideline adaptation process was conducted according to the guideline adaptation manual which consists of three main phases, and 9 modules with a total of 24 steps. Results: The newly developed IUC guideline consisted of an introduction, urinary catheterization, summary of recommendations, recommendations, references, and appendices. There were 110 recommendations in 8 sections including assessment, equipment, catheter insertion, catheter maintenance, catheter change, catheter removal, management of complications, and education/consultation. For the grade of recommendations, there were 6.4% for A, 22.7% for B, 67.3% for C. Conclusion: The IUC guideline was developed based on evidence and therefore it is recommended that this guideline be disseminated and utilized by nurses nationwide to improve the quality of care for patients with IUC and decrease complications related to IUC and that it be revised regularly.

호스피스 스마트 환자 서비스 제공자를 위한 교육과정 개발 (Development of Educational Program for Hospice Smart Patient Service Provider)

  • 박재순;유양숙;박현정;최동원;최상옥;김성은;김효정
    • 종양간호연구
    • /
    • 제9권1호
    • /
    • pp.43-51
    • /
    • 2009
  • Purpose: The purpose of the study was to develop an educational program reflecting the educational needs of Hospice Smart Patient service providers. Method: The description, goal, curriculum, method, and process evaluation of the educational program were constructed based on Modified Tyler-type Ends-Means Model followed by the analysis of current curriculum and needs of service providers. Results: The curriculum was constructed based on hospice volunteer program currently offered in Korea and the recommendations of hospice service volunteers and experts. A total of 90 hr was required to complete the curriculum that was composed of 'Introduction to cancer', 'Treatment and treatment complications of cancer', 'Post-treatment nutritional care', 'Helpful information', 'Introduction to hospice and palliative care', 'Comprehension of life and death', 'Holistic hospice and palliative care', 'How to communicate as a smart patient', 'Hospice and ethics', 'Pediatric hospice', 'Bereavement management', and 'Clinical practicum'. Conclusion: It is necessary to implement the developed educational program and evaluate its effectiveness, as well as making the service available to a greater number of cancer patients.
